DrunkenOnzo t1_j20pjrq wrote
Reply to comment by Giants_Orbiting in ELI5: How is that Pantone colors don't have direct RGB counterparts? by ExternalUserError
It's the smallest possible length at which length can be defined. I brought it up originally because it's a length derived from universal constants; so even if we met aliens who have no understanding of how we measure, or do math, we will be able to translate our distances and their distances using planck-lengths. 1 miles = ______ planck lengths. 1 Blorb = ______ Plancklengths, so you can convert blorbs to miles without ever taking out a tape measure.
